Storm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small sink overflow on tile floor | Yes | No | You can easily clean up a small spill with a wet vacuum and some towels. |
| Flooded basement with standing water | No | Yes | You need professional equ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ove standing water and prevent further damage. |
| Wet drywall behind cabinets | No | Yes | You need spec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ove wet drywall and prevent mold growth. |
| Roof damage from hail storm | No | Yes | You need a professional to assess and repair roof damage to prevent further leaks and damage. |
| Leaky pipe under kitchen sink | Yes | No | You can easily shut off the water supply and fix the leak yourself with a wrench and some Teflon tape. |
| Basement flood with sewage backup | No | Yes | You need a professional to safely and effectively clean up sewage and restore your home to a safe living condition. |

Storm Damage Restoration Cost In The 78615 Area
Prices for storm damage restoration services in the 78615 area v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Extraction | $500-$2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of standing water, and equipment needed. |
| Structural Drying Process | $1,000-$5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ected, and equipment needed. |
| Moisture Detection and Monitoring | $300-$1,500 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ected, and equipment needed. |
| Sewage Cleanup | $1,500-$5,000 | Size of affected area, type of sewage, and equipment needed. |
| Basement Flood Recovery | $2,000-$10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ected, and equipment needed. |
| Post-Remediation Verification |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area and type of materials affected. |
